背景技术Background technique
体腔积液是临床常见病症,如胸腔积液、腹腔积液等,治疗的重要方法是通过穿刺将积液排出。胸腔穿刺术、腹腔穿刺术是临床医师必须掌握的穿刺技术,常规操作是在体腔内放置引流管后外接引流袋,引流过程中,如需取得积液标本进行化验或通过引流管注射药品到体腔进行治疗时,需要拿掉引流袋,体腔置管端口暴露在空气中,增加外界细菌感染和积液渗漏的机会,同时增加医护用于消毒和更换引流袋的工作量。鉴于此,我们提出一种可同时完成注药及标本采集功能的体液收集装置。Body cavity effusion is a common clinical disease, such as pleural effusion, ascites, etc., an important method of treatment is to drain the effusion through puncture. Thoracentesis and paracentesis are puncture techniques that clinicians must master. The routine operation is to place a drainage tube in the body cavity and then connect a drainage bag. During the drainage process, if you need to obtain fluid samples for testing or inject drugs into the body cavity through the drainage tube During treatment, the drainage bag needs to be removed, and the body cavity catheter port is exposed to the air, which increases the chances of external bacterial infection and fluid leakage, and increases the workload of medical staff for disinfection and replacement of the drainage bag. In view of this, we propose a body fluid collection device that can simultaneously complete the functions of drug injection and specimen collection.

与现有技术相比,本实用新型的有益效果是:本实用新型通过在传统引流袋与穿刺管之间增加三通阀,医护人员可在不破坏引流管密闭性前提下,取用注射器通过三通阀完成积液标本采集、药物体腔注射和外部引流管的冲洗清洁,降低反复拆卸引流袋导致的污染问题,并减少医护工作量、降低耗材使用量。Compared with the prior art, the beneficial effects of the present utility model are: the utility model adds a three-way valve between the traditional drainage bag and the puncture tube, so that medical staff can use a syringe to pass The three-way valve completes the collection of effusion samples, the injection of drugs into the body cavity and the flushing and cleaning of the external drainage tube, which reduces the pollution caused by repeated disassembly of the drainage bag, reduces the workload of medical care and reduces the consumption of consumables.

具体地,当需要取得积液标本时,先取用空的无菌的注射器4,将注射器4的乳头卡接到侧通管23内,旋动阀门旋钮24使上通管22与侧通管23连通,抽动注射器4的活塞杆即可取得新鲜的积液标本;当需要通过引流管注射药品时,先旋动阀门旋钮24使上通管22与侧通管23连通,取用注射器4抽取药品后再卡接到侧通管23内进行注射即可;当需要对引流管进行冲洗清洁时,先旋动阀门旋钮24使上通管22与侧通管23连通,取用注射器4抽取适量的清洗液卡接到侧通管23内,将清洗液注入,然后旋动阀门旋钮24使下通管21与上通管22连通,通过引流袋1将清洗液引流下来,清洗液流经第二引流管31和第一引流管11完成了对引流管的清洁。Specifically, when the effusion sample needs to be obtained, an empty sterile syringe 4 is taken first, the nipple of the syringe 4 is clamped into the side passage tube 23, and the valve knob 24 is rotated to make the upper passage tube 22 and the side passage tube 23 Connect, pull the piston rod of the syringe 4 to obtain a fresh effusion sample; when it is necessary to inject medicine through the drainage tube, first rotate the valve knob 24 to connect the upper through tube 22 with the side through tube 23, and use the syringe 4 to extract the medicine Then clip into the side passage pipe 23 for injection; when the drainage pipe needs to be rinsed and cleaned, first rotate the valve knob 24 to make the upper passage pipe 22 communicate with the side passage pipe 23, and use the syringe 4 to extract an appropriate amount of The cleaning liquid is clamped into the side channel 23, the cleaning solution is injected, and then the valve knob 24 is rotated to connect the lower channel 21 and the upper channel 22, the cleaning solution is drained through the drainage bag 1, and the cleaning solution flows through the second channel. The drainage tube 31 and the first drainage tube 11 complete the cleaning of the drainage tube.

本实用新型的可同时完成注药及标本采集功能的体液收集装置在使用时,首先取用收集装置,按照常规操作将穿刺管3插入患者体内并固定住,再旋动阀门旋钮24使下通管21与上通管22连通,通过引流袋1对积液进行引流,当需要对抽取积液标本、药物体腔注射或引流管冲洗的操作时,旋动阀门旋钮24使上通管22与侧通管23连通,拔出胶塞25并取用注射器4进行常规操作即可,操作完成后将胶塞25重新塞紧;当引流袋1快灌满时,先取用止血钳将连接软管51夹紧,再快速将第一引流管11从连接筒5内拧出,取用新的无菌引流袋1连接到连接筒5内,最后移除止血钳即可。When the body fluid collection device of the present invention, which can simultaneously complete the functions of drug injection and specimen collection, is used, the collection device is firstly taken, and the puncture tube 3 is inserted into the body of the patient according to the routine operation and fixed, and then the valve knob 24 is rotated to make the downward passage The tube 21 is communicated with the upper passage tube 22, and the effusion is drained through the drainage bag 1. When it is necessary to extract the effusion specimen, inject the drug into the body cavity or flush the drainage tube, turn the valve knob 24 to make the upper passage tube 22 connect to the side. The tube 23 is connected, pull out the rubber stopper 25 and use the syringe 4 for routine operations. After the operation is completed, re-tighten the rubber stopper 25; Clamp, then quickly unscrew the first drainage tube 11 from the connecting cylinder 5, take a new sterile drainage bag 1 and connect it into the connecting cylinder 5, and finally remove the hemostatic forceps.
